The Secret Garden

-

Give or take a few kilometres, there's approximat­ely 7000km between Bali and Waihi Beach. If that distance is daunting, the Secret Garden is here to provide a little tropical sanctuary, without boarding a plane or packing a suitcase. Owner Jayne Jolly has turned one the village's original baches into a multifacet­ed Balinese-inspired store, eatery and garden. Start at Shipshape – a homeware and clothing boutique with a range of NZ designers and thoughtful­ly sourced brands. With bags in hand, head inside the garden to The Pod, which serves takeaway Allpress coffee, smoothies and freshly baked goods (ask about the Portuguese egg tarts). Tables are tucked away in the tropical garden, with large palms hiding other shopping nooks. During summer there is live music and small events. 17 Wilson Road, Waihi Beach.
